Flow begins with preparation. Before the sale, review your target lots and assign each a priority score based on grade, category familiarity, and average sold price. Then, set up a three-stage timer: an “early bid” at 20% of your max to signal seriousness, a “mid-auction” check at halfway through the time allotted, and a final “snipe window” in the last 5–10 seconds. These time checkpoints anchor you, so you never lose track of where you stand.


The real art lies in that final snipe. Resist the urge to wildly overshoot—your goal is to bid just enough to beat the current high by the minimum increment. Practice this on low-value lots first, refining your reaction time until you can place the bid within one second of your target. Many pro bidders use a smartphone stopwatch alongside the HiBid clock, mentally rehearsing the final-second sprint until it becomes muscle memory.

When the rush subsides, don’t let analysis paralysis set in. Immediately after each session, spend two minutes reviewing your timers: did you snipe too early? Too late? Adjust your mid-auction check next time. This rapid feedback loop ingrains best practices and accelerates your growth.
